SAP ABAP Class CL_WD_GLOBAL_PARAMETERS_ASSIST (Assistance Class for WD_GLOBAL_PARAMETERS)
Hierarchy
☛
SAP_UI (Software Component) User Interface Technology
⤷ BC-WD-ABA (Application Component) Web Dynpro ABAP
⤷ SWDP_CONFIGURATION (Package) Configuration for WD4A
⤷ BC-WD-ABA (Application Component) Web Dynpro ABAP
⤷ SWDP_CONFIGURATION (Package) Configuration for WD4A
Meta Relationship - Using
# | Relationship type | Using | Short Description | Created on |
---|---|---|---|---|
1 | Inheritance (c INHERITING FROM c_ref) | CL_WD_COMPONENT_ASSISTANCE | Basis for a Web Dynpro assistance class | 20100702 |
Properties
Class | CL_WD_GLOBAL_PARAMETERS_ASSIST | |
Short Description | Assistance Class for WD_GLOBAL_PARAMETERS | |
Super Class | CL_WD_COMPONENT_ASSISTANCE | Basis for a Web Dynpro assistance class |
Instantiability of a Class | 2 | Public |
Final |
General Data
Message Class | ||
Program status | ||
Category | 0 | |
Package | SWDP_CONFIGURATION | Configuration for WD4A |
Created | 20100702 | SAP |
Last change | 20110908 | SAP |
Shared Memory-enabled | ||
Fixed point arithmetic | ||
Unicode checks active |
Forward declarations
# | Type group / Object type | Type | Type Description |
---|---|---|---|
1 | ABAP | Type group use (TYPE-POOLS tp) | Type group use (TYPE-POOLS tp) |
2 | CL_WD_MATRIX_DATA | Forward declaration class (CLASS c DEFINITION DEFERRED) | Forward declaration class (CLASS c DEFINITION DEFERRED) |
Interfaces
Class CL_WD_GLOBAL_PARAMETERS_ASSIST has no interface implemented.
Friends
Class CL_WD_GLOBAL_PARAMETERS_ASSIST has no friend class.
Attributes
# | Attribute | Level | Visibility | Read only | Typing | Associated Type | Initial Value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| CO_COLSPAN_DEF_VALUE | Constant | Private | Type reference (TYPE) | I | -1 | ColSpan Default Value (Form Layout) | 20100702 | |
2 | CO_COLSPAN_DESCRIPTION | Constant | Private | Type reference (TYPE) | I | 4 | ColSpan Parameter (Form Layout) | 20100702 | |
3 | CO_COLSPAN_LAST_CHANGE | Constant | Private | Type reference (TYPE) | I | -1 | ColSpan Last Change (Form Layout) | 20100702 | |
4 | CO_COLSPAN_RESET | Constant | Private | Type reference (TYPE) | I | 1 | ColSpan Reset Buttons (Form Layout) | 20100702 | |
5 | CO_COLSPAN_URL | Constant | Private | Type reference (TYPE) | I | -1 | ColSpan URL Parameter (Form Layout) | 20100702 | |
6 | CO_COLSPAN_VALUE | Constant | Private | Type reference (TYPE) | I | 3 | ColSpan Value (Form Layout) | 20100702 | |
7 | CO_COLUMNS | Constant | Private | Type reference (TYPE) | I | 12 | Number of Columns (Form Layout) | 20100702 | |
8 | CO_EXCLUDE_PARAMETERS | Constant | Private | Type reference (TYPE) | STRING | `WD_CFG_CMP_SHARED,WDLIGHTSPEED,WDTABLENAVIGATION` | List of Obsolete Parameters (Form:`PAR1,PAR2,PAR3,...`) | 20100702 | |
9 | M_APP_PROP_DEF_TAB | Instance attribute | Private | Type reference (TYPE) | WDY_CONF_APPL_PROP_DEF_TAB | Web Dynpro: Application Property Definition | 20100702 | ||
10 | M_WDY_SETTINGS | Instance attribute | Private | Type reference (TYPE) | WDY_SETTINGS_TABLE | Table with Global WD Settings | 20100702 |
Methods
# | Method | Level | Visibility | Method type | Description | Created on |
---|---|---|---|---|---|---|
1 | ADD_CAPTION_LINE | Instance method | Private | Method | Adds the headings | 20100702 |
2 | ADD_FORMATTED_TEXT_VIEW | Instance method | Private | Method | Adds a formatted text | 20100702 |
3 | ADD_TEXTVIEW | Instance method | Private | Method | Adds a text view element | 20100702 |
4 | ADD_TRANSPARENT_CONTAINER_GL | Instance method | Private | Method | Adds a transparent container with grid layout | 20100702 |
5 | CHANGE_VALUE | Instance method | Public | Method | Is called when a parameter is changed (activate reset) | 20100702 |
6 | CHECK_CHANGES | Instance method | Public | Method | Checks changes to parameters | 20100702 |
7 | CLEAR_CONTEXT | Instance method | Private | Method | Deletes the context | 20100702 |
8 | CONSTRUCTOR | Instance method | Public | Constructor | CONSTRUCTOR | 20100702 |
9 | CREATE_PARAMETER_CONTEXT | Instance method | Private | Method | Generates the context for application parameters | 20100702 |
10 | CREATE_PARAMETER_FORM | Instance method | Public | Method | Generates form for parameters | 20100702 |
11 | CREATE_PARAMETER_FORM_LAYOUT | Instance method | Private | Method | Generate Form for Changing Parameters | 20100702 |
12 | DEQUEUE | Instance method | Public | Method | Reset Lock | 20100702 |
13 | ENQUEUE | Instance method | Public | Method | Set Lock | 20100702 |
14 | GET_DDIC_FIXED_VALUE | Instance method | Private | Method | Returns the fixed value for a data type | 20100702 |
15 | GET_TEXT | Instance method | Public | Method | 20100702 | |
16 | GET_VALUES_FOR_PARAMETER | Static method | Public | Method | Returns possible values for a parameter | 20100702 |
17 | INIT_PARAMETERS_FROM_DB | Instance method | Private | Method | Reads the parameter values from the database | 20100702 |
18 | IS_AUTHORIZED | Instance method | Public | Method | Authorization Check | 20100702 |
19 | RESET_VALUE | Instance method | Public | Method | Resets a value to the default value | 20100702 |
20 | SAVE | Instance method | Public | Method | Saves the application parameters | 20100702 |
Events
Class CL_WD_GLOBAL_PARAMETERS_ASSIST has no event.
Types
Class CL_WD_GLOBAL_PARAMETERS_ASSIST has no local type.
Method Signatures
Method ADD_CAPTION_LINE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| ID | Call by reference | Type reference (TYPE) | I | 20100702 | |||
2 | Importing | PANEL | Call by reference | Object reference (TYPE REF TO) | CL_WD_PANEL | 20100702 |
Method ADD_CAPTION_LINE on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method ADD_FORMATTED_TEXT_VIEW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| BIND_VISIBLE | Call by reference | Type reference (TYPE) | STRING | 20100702 | |||
2 | Importing | COL_SPAN | Call by reference | Type reference (TYPE) | I | -1 | 20100702 | ||
3 | Returning | FORMATTED_TEXT_VIEW | Value transfer | Object reference (TYPE REF TO) | CL_WD_FORMATTED_TEXT_VIEW | 20100702 | |||
4 | Importing | ID | Call by reference | Type reference (TYPE) | STRING | 20100702 | |||
5 | Importing | TEXT | Call by reference | Type reference (TYPE) | CSEQUENCE | 20100702 | |||
6 | Importing | TOOLTIP | Call by reference | Type reference (TYPE) | CSEQUENCE | 20100702 |
Method ADD_FORMATTED_TEXT_VIEW on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method ADD_TEXTVIEW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| BIND_VISIBLE | Call by reference | Type reference (TYPE) | STRING | 20100702 | |||
2 | Importing | COL_SPAN | Call by reference | Type reference (TYPE) | I | -1 | 20100702 | ||
3 | Importing | ID | Call by reference | Type reference (TYPE) | CSEQUENCE | 20100702 | |||
4 | Importing | LAYOUT_TYPE | Call by reference | Type reference (TYPE) | I | 2 | 0:TOP 1:HEAD 2:DATA | 20100702 | |
5 | Importing | TEXT | Call by reference | Type reference (TYPE) | CSEQUENCE | 20100702 | |||
6 | Returning | TEXTVIEW | Value transfer | Object reference (TYPE REF TO) | CL_WD_TEXT_VIEW | 20100702 | |||
7 | Importing | TOOLTIP | Call by reference | Type reference (TYPE) | STRING | 20100702 |
Method ADD_TEXTVIEW on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method ADD_TRANSPARENT_CONTAINER_GL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| COL_SPAN | Call by reference | Type reference (TYPE) | I | -1 | 20100702 | ||
2 | Importing | ID | Call by reference | Type reference (TYPE) | STRING | 20100702 | |||
3 | Importing | LAYOUT_TYPE | Call by reference | Type reference (TYPE) | I | 2 | 0:Top 1:Head 2:Data | 20100702 | |
4 | Returning | TRANSPARENTCONTAINER | Value transfer | Object reference (TYPE REF TO) | CL_WD_TRANSPARENT_CONTAINER | 20100702 |
Method ADD_TRANSPARENT_CONTAINER_GL on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method CHANGE_VALUE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| CONTEXT_NODE | Call by reference | Object reference (TYPE REF TO) | IF_WD_CONTEXT_NODE | WebDynpro: Schnittstelle für Kontext Knoten | 20100702 | ||
2 | Importing | ID | Call by reference | Type reference (TYPE) | STRING | 20100702 |
Method CHANGE_VALUE on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method CHECK_CHANGES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| CONTEXT_NODE | Call by reference | Object reference (TYPE REF TO) | IF_WD_CONTEXT_NODE | Web Dynpro: Liste mit Context-Änderungen | 20100702 |
Method CHECK_CHANGES on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method CLEAR_CONTEXT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| CONTEXT_NODE | Call by reference | Object reference (TYPE REF TO) | IF_WD_CONTEXT_NODE | WebDynpro: Schnittstelle für Kontext Knoten | 20100702 |
Method CLEAR_CONTEXT on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method CONSTRUCTOR Signature
Method CONSTRUCTOR on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no parameter.
Method CONSTRUCTOR on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method CREATE_PARAMETER_CONTEXT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| CONTEXT_NODE | Call by reference | Object reference (TYPE REF TO) | IF_WD_CONTEXT_NODE | WebDynpro: Schnittstelle für Kontext Knoten | 20100702 |
Method CREATE_PARAMETER_CONTEXT on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method CREATE_PARAMETER_FORM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| CONTEXT_NODE | Call by reference | Object reference (TYPE REF TO) | IF_WD_CONTEXT_NODE | WebDynpro: Schnittstelle für Kontext Knoten | 20100702 | ||
2 | Importing | FORM | Call by reference | Object reference (TYPE REF TO) | CL_WD_TRANSPARENT_CONTAINER | 20100702 |
Method CREATE_PARAMETER_FORM on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method CREATE_PARAMETER_FORM_LAYOUT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| FORM | Call by reference | Object reference (TYPE REF TO) | CL_WD_TRANSPARENT_CONTAINER | 20100702 | |||
2 | Importing | L_BIND_PREFIX | Call by reference | Type reference (TYPE) | STRING | 20100702 |
Method CREATE_PARAMETER_FORM_LAYOUT on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method DEQUEUE Signature
Method DEQUEUE on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no parameter.
Method DEQUEUE on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method ENQUEUE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| COMPONENT_API | Call by reference | Object reference (TYPE REF TO) | IF_WD_COMPONENT | Web Dynpro: Controller-Schnittstelle | 20100702 | ||
2 | Returning | IS_OK | Value transfer | Type reference (TYPE) | WDY_BOOLEAN | Ersatz für echten boolschen Typ: 'X' == wahr '' == falsch | 20100702 |
Method ENQUEUE on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method GET_DDIC_FIXED_VALUE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| DATATYPE | Call by reference | Type reference (TYPE) | CSEQUENCE | 20100702 | |||
2 | Importing | KEY | Call by reference | Type reference (TYPE) | DATA | 20100702 | |||
3 | Returning | TEXT | Value transfer | Type reference (TYPE) | STRING | 20100702 |
Method GET_DDIC_FIXED_VALUE on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method GET_TEXT Signature
Method GET_TEXT on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no parameter.
Method GET_TEXT on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method GET_VALUES_FOR_PARAMETER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Returning | FIXED_VALUES | Value transfer | Type reference (TYPE) | DDFIXVALUES | Beschreibung von Domänen-Festwerten | 20100702 | ||
2 | Importing | PROPERTY_NAME | Call by reference | Type reference (TYPE) | WDY_MD_OBJECT_NAME | Web Dynpro : Name eines Web Dynpro Metadaten Objekts | 20100702 | ||
3 | Importing | SET_NAME | Call by reference | Type reference (TYPE) | WDY_MD_OBJECT_NAME | `STANDARD` | Web Dynpro : Name eines Web Dynpro Metadaten Objekts | 20100702 |
Method GET_VALUES_FOR_PARAMETER on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method INIT_PARAMETERS_FROM_DB Signature
Method INIT_PARAMETERS_FROM_DB on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no parameter.
Method INIT_PARAMETERS_FROM_DB on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method IS_AUTHORIZED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| COMPONENT_API | Call by reference | Object reference (TYPE REF TO) | IF_WD_COMPONENT | Web Dynpro: Component | 20100702 | ||
2 | Returning | IS_OK | Value transfer | Type reference (TYPE) | ABAP_BOOL | Ersatz für echten boolschen Typ: 'X' == wahr '' == falsch | 20100702 |
Method IS_AUTHORIZED on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method RESET_VALUE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| BUTTON_NAME | Call by reference | Type reference (TYPE) | STRING | 20100702 | |||
2 | Importing | CONTEXT_NODE | Call by reference | Object reference (TYPE REF TO) | IF_WD_CONTEXT_NODE | WebDynpro: Schnittstelle für Kontext Knoten | 20100702 |
Method RESET_VALUE on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
Method SAVE Signature
# | Type | Parameter | Pass Value | Optional | Typing Method | Associated Type | Default value | Description | Created on |
---|---|---|---|---|---|---|---|---|---|
1 | Importing | CONTEXT_NODE | Value transfer | Object reference (TYPE REF TO) | IF_WD_CONTEXT_NODE | Web Dynpro: Liste mit Context-Änderungen | 20100702 |
Method SAVE on class CL_WD_GLOBAL_PARAMETERS_ASSIST has no exception.
History
Last changed by/on | SAP | 20110908 |
SAP Release Created in | 703 |